NUT GOODIE BARS | |
12 oz. pkg. chocolate chips 12 oz. pkg. butterscotch chips 18 oz. jar of creamy peanut butter 16 oz. jar of dry roasted peanuts 1 c. butter 1/4 c. (dry) vanilla pudding mix (NOT instant) 1/2 c. milk 2 lbs. of powdered sugar 1 tsp. maple flavoring Melt chips and peanut butter. Spread out half of chip mixture onto jelly roll pan and refrigerate. Add peanuts to other half of chip mixture and set aside. Combine butter, pudding mix and milk. Boil 1 minute, stirring constantly so as not to burn. Remove from heat and add powdered sugar and maple flavoring. Beat until smooth (you may want to use electric mixer). Spread on top of first layer of chip mixture. Cool in refrigerator. Then spread remaining chip mixture with peanuts on top of sugar mixture. Refrigerate. Cut bars very small. These will freeze well. |
